FAQs

1. What does Kadence Touring Series Lemon Oil Cream do?
It cleans accumulated dirt, sweat, and finger oils while conditioning and protecting unfinished fretboards. It helps restore the natural appearance and feel of the wood while supporting long-term fretboard health.
2. Which fretboard woods are compatible with this product?
It is recommended for rosewood, ebony, pau ferro, laurel, walnut, and other unfinished hardwood fretboards commonly found on guitars, basses, ukuleles, mandolins, and banjos.
3. Can I use it on maple fretboards?
It is not recommended for finished or lacquered maple fretboards. These surfaces generally require different cleaning methods and do not typically need conditioning oils.
4. How often should I use the lemon oil cream?
Most players can use it every 3–6 months or during regular string changes. Instruments exposed to dry climates may benefit from more frequent conditioning.
5. Will it make my fretboard slippery or greasy?
No. The fast-absorbing formula is designed to condition the wood without leaving excessive residue, helping maintain a natural playing feel.
6. Does it help prevent fretboard cracking?
Yes. By replenishing moisture in dry fretboards, the cream helps reduce the likelihood of drying, shrinkage, and cracking caused by environmental conditions.
7. Can it remove years of dirt buildup?
It effectively removes common dirt, sweat, and grime buildup. Extremely neglected fretboards may require multiple cleaning sessions for best results.
8. Is it safe for vintage instruments?
When used as directed on compatible unfinished fretboards, it is suitable for maintaining vintage and modern instruments alike. Always test on a small area if uncertain.
9. Can I use it on bass guitars and ukuleles?
Yes. It is compatible with bass guitars, ukuleles, mandolins, banjos, and similar stringed instruments featuring unfinished hardwood fretboards.
10. Does it improve playing comfort?
Yes. A clean and properly conditioned fretboard feels smoother under the fingers, contributing to a more comfortable playing experience.
11. Does the product contain a strong chemical smell?
No. It features a pleasant lemon fragrance that helps freshen the instrument care process without being overpowering.
12. When is the best time to apply the cream?
The ideal time is during string changes when the entire fretboard surface is accessible for thorough cleaning and conditioning.
